Yeah that white stuff is bad stuff... This car is terrible in the snow. HP summer tires and snow aren't a good combination!

I'll try and get a sound clip tonight. It's pretty darn loud though, I may end up toning it down a bit. It probably sounds a little bit different on my car since I'm running the R/T midpipe (different from SXT and SRT) at high RPM it's pretty raspy, but I daily drive this car so it never sees over 3500rpm anyway.

I need to get a SRT4 rear bumper cover, the SRT exhaust doesn't fit in the stock R/T dual exhaust cutouts, and I refuse to hack up the R/T cover, so it looks a little bad, still not as bad as what it did look like with the non R/T muffler on it. So when I get the drivers quarter repainted and blended in I'll have my bodyshop take care of the bumper cover too.
